- 1、本文档共35页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
多目标优化下的调度算法研究
多目标优化问题概述
调度算法的分类与特点
多目标优化调度算法的性能指标
多目标优化调度算法的设计方法
多目标优化调度算法的实现技术
多目标优化调度算法的应用领域
多目标优化调度算法的最新进展
多目标优化调度算法的未来发展ContentsPage目录页
多目标优化问题概述多目标优化下的调度算法研究
#.多目标优化问题概述多目标优化问题定义:1.多目标优化问题是指通过考虑多个相互冲突的目标来确定决策变量的最佳值。2.优化目标之间通常存在竞争或权衡关系,无法同时达到最优。3.多目标优化问题在许多领域都有广泛应用,如工程设计、资源分配、投资组合优化等。多目标优化问题分类:1.基于帕累托最优性的方法:帕累托最优是指在不损害任何一个目标的情况下,无法改善任何其他目标。2.基于加权和的方法:将各个目标按一定权重进行加权求和,得到一个单一的综合目标,然后对综合目标进行优化。3.基于目标规划的方法:将目标分为硬目标和软目标,硬目标必须满足,软目标尽可能满足。
#.多目标优化问题概述多目标优化问题求解方法:1.启发式算法:如遗传算法、粒子群算法、模拟退火算法等,通过随机搜索和迭代优化来寻找最优解。2.精确算法:如分支定界法、动态规划等,能够保证找到最优解,但计算复杂度通常很高。3.交互式方法:如决策者参与式优化,决策者在优化过程中与算法交互,逐步改进优化结果。多目标优化问题应用:1.工程设计:如设计最轻、最强的飞机机翼,设计最节能、最舒适的汽车等。2.资源分配:如分配有限的资源来优化项目收益,分配人力资源来优化生产效率等。3.投资组合优化:如选择最优的投资组合来实现最高回报和最低风险等。
#.多目标优化问题概述多目标优化问题前沿研究方向:1.多目标优化问题的理论研究:如多目标优化问题求解算法的研究、多目标优化问题的复杂性分析等。2.多目标优化问题的应用研究:如多目标优化在工程设计、资源分配、投资组合优化等领域的应用。3.多目标优化问题的软件开发:如多目标优化求解器、多目标优化应用程序等。多目标优化问题未来发展趋势:1.多目标优化算法的研究将继续深入,新的算法将被开发出来,以提高求解效率和精度。2.多目标优化问题将在越来越多的领域得到应用,如环境保护、医疗保健、社会科学等。
调度算法的分类与特点多目标优化下的调度算法研究
调度算法的分类与特点静态调度算法1.静态调度算法是一种在任务分配之前就确定任务的执行顺序和执行时间。2.静态调度算法主要分为先来先服务(FCFS)、短作业优先(SJF)、优先级调度和轮询调度等。3.静态调度算法简单易于实现,但缺乏灵活性,无法适应任务动态变化的情况。动态调度算法1.动态调度算法是一种在任务执行过程中根据任务的执行情况调整任务的执行顺序和执行时间。2.动态调度算法主要分为时间片轮转调度算法、优先级调度算法、最短作业优先调度算法和多级反馈队列调度算法等。3.动态调度算法更灵活,能够适应任务动态变化的情况,但实现也更加复杂。
调度算法的分类与特点启发式调度算法1.启发式调度算法是指在没有完整信息的情况下利用经验或直觉来做出决策的算法。2.启发式调度算法通常用于解决复杂的任务调度问题。3.启发式调度算法通常不能保证找到最优解,但通常可以找到较好且可接受的解。混合调度算法1.混合调度算法是将多种调度算法组合起来的一种调度算法。2.混合调度算法可以结合不同调度算法的优点,弥补单一调度算法的不足。3.混合调度算法通常可以获得更好的调度性能。
调度算法的分类与特点分布式调度算法1.分布式调度算法是指在分布式系统中进行任务调度的算法。2.分布式调度算法需要解决任务分配、负载均衡、故障恢复等问题。3.分布式调度算法可以提高分布式系统的资源利用率和性能。自适应调度算法1.自适应调度算法是指能够根据系统运行环境的变化而动态调整调度策略的算法。2.自适应调度算法可以提高系统的鲁棒性和适应性。3.自适应调度算法是未来调度算法的发展方向之一。
多目标优化调度算法的性能指标多目标优化下的调度算法研究
多目标优化调度算法的性能指标计算时间1.计算时间是指优化算法在给定时间内完成多目标优化任务所花费的时间。2.计算时间是一个重要的性能指标,它可以反映优化算法的效率和收敛速度。3.计算时间与优化算法的复杂度、搜索空间的大小、优化目标的数量等因素有关。算法复杂度1.算法复杂度是指算法在给定输入规模下的时间和空间消耗。2.算法复杂度可以分为时间复杂度和空间复杂度。3.时间复杂度表示算法在给定输入规模下的运行时间,空间复杂度表示算法在给定输入规模下所需的存储空间。
多目标优化调度算法的性能指标收敛速度1.收敛
文档评论(0)